Nlies, just saw your post disagreeing with me. My post was poorly worded. Your post is accurate with the following caveat. All of the ASIC listed suppliers are licensed to sell ASICs according to the limitations in their licensing agreement. According to Julie McClure (Qualcomm IR) all of the licenses are different and Qualcomm has never disclosed those limitations or terms (other than the press releases). I cannot find the original Agere press release, but my memory is that they are licensed only for modem cards.

Regardless, Qualcomm has no problem licensing ASIC suppliers who may want to manufacture their own chips and sell them to the mass market. Bottom line is no one yet has come close to being able to compete with Qualcomm's chip sets. As you say, it remains to be seen whether or not Samsung will be competitive. To the extent that it may help to grow the market I welcome them.
